cardboard canvas

Cardboard canvas refers to a sturdy, flat surface made from cardboard that is used by artists for painting, drawing, or crafting. It serves as an alternative to traditional canvas, offering a lightweight and economical option for various art projects.

FAQs

When selecting a cardboard canvas, consider the thickness and texture that suits your preferred medium. Thicker cardboard is better for heavy paint applications, while textured surfaces can enhance the visual interest of your artwork.

Look for features such as durability, surface texture, and size. Ensure the cardboard canvas is sturdy enough to hold your chosen medium without warping or bending.

One common mistake is choosing a cardboard canvas that is too thin for heavy applications. Always check the specifications to ensure it meets your artistic needs.

Cardboard canvas is primarily designed for indoor use. If you plan to display your artwork outdoors, consider sealing it with a protective varnish to enhance its durability.

Cardboard canvas works well with various mediums such as acrylic paints, watercolors, markers, and even collage materials. Experiment with different techniques to find what you enjoy the most.
